基于拉格朗日公式的水流路径算法研究
Research on Flow Paths Algorithm Based on Lagrange Formula
【摘要】 提出了一种水流路径算法,该算法通过以各格网点为中心建立3×3窗口内基于6条拉格朗日曲线构成的局部曲面,再利用当前点在局部曲面中的等高线曲率选取合适的单流向算法以确定当前点的水流方向及其向下游点的流量分配比例。最后通过实例证明了该方法在水流累积量计算中的良好效果。
【Abstract】 In this paper,a flow path algorithm is proposed,a piece of partial surface based on 6 curves using Lagrange formula is established through every grid point in the 3×3 grid points area which have x,y and z values,and through the contour curvature of the current center grid point of the partial surface,the right single flow direction algorithm will be selected so as to calculate the flow direction of current point and its distribution ratio of water flow to its downstream point.Finally,good results using this method in the accumulation of the water are proved.
